IELTS Fee Structure in Pakistan (2026 )
As of 2026, candidates in Pakistan need to prepare for changes in the Ielts Exam Fees Pakistan fee structure that might result from inflation and other financial factors. Below is a summary of the anticipated fees related to the IELTS test:
Test TypeEstimated Fee (PKR)DetailsIELTS Academic35,000For individuals looking for collegeIELTS General Training35,000For those planning to immigrate or work abroadIELTS for UKVI45,000For UK visa applicationsIELTS Life Skills30,000For those obtaining family visas to the UKExtra Costs

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: What is the credibility of IELTS ratings in Pakistan?
A1: IELTS scores stand for 2 years from the test date, after which a candidate should retake the exam to revalidate their efficiency.
Q2: Can I pay the IELTS fees online in Pakistan?
A2: Yes, the majority of test centers in Pakistan offer online payment options for convenience.
Q3: How quickly can I retake the IELTS exam?
A3: Candidates can retake the Ielts Pakistan Fees exam as quickly as they are all set, without any obligatory waiting period.
Q4: Are there any discount rates available for numerous test registrations?
A4: Currently, there are no widely acknowledged discount rates, but prospects need to examine with their local test center for potential offers.
Q5: What recognition is needed for the IELTS exam?
A5: A government-issued ID, such as a national identity card or passport, is needed to register and take the test.
